Time for change meeting
Hi All,
I have been asked to support a proposal to be delivered to all North Wales leagues who play under the NWPA by Zak Shepherd the chairman of the Welsh Eightball Federation.

The proposals will be discussed in length at a meeting arranged as below:

Venue…..

Gwersyllt workingmen’s club
Mold Road
Wrexham

Date and time……

Sunday 19th October 2025 at 12.00 noon

The meeting will be open to all who wish to attend from all leagues and players to discuss the proposals and to submit this to the AGM in December for members to vote on.

Point of discussion ……..

To discuss the current and past actions of the WPA who are intent in causing a divide in Wales with the North / South system, which is not in any other country under any organisation.

The banning / Choice policy put in place by the WPA resulting in players not being able to play pool without sanctions being imposed.

Here are the proposals in summary…….

1) Leave the WPA and self affiliate as NWPA.

2) Affiliate to the Welsh eightball federation. The NWPA will still keep all affiliation fees to support its structure.

3) Everything remains the same within the NWPA. Support from the (WEF) will be given to allow more compatible events going forward.

4) Additional IR events added to the calendar in North Wales clubs and venues including trials for all age categories each year. The NWPA will not be expected to organise these events and the clubs concerned will be contacted to arrange these events as and when required.

5) All existing WPA players offered to move to IR squads if they wish to do so. This concept only affects a small number of players in North Wales who do play international pool and a great offer if they wish to swop.

6) NWPA will be the organisation who send teams to the (BI) blackball international events in future at all squad levels with support from the (WEF).

7) Qualifiers put in place each year for squad selection at both rule sets for all age categories. This will be done in a more structured manner to allow fairness to all players.

😎 Any existing WPA players who wish to continue playing for the WPA teams can do so without any bans sanctioned from the WEF point of view. However the WPA current banning policy will impose sanctions on those players playing (IR) in Wales.

9)New super league event put in place for all league team champions in the top divisions like a champions league format at blackball rules (2027). This will be set up during (2026) and all leagues informed once organised.

10)There will be no banning / choice policy towards players wishing to simply play pool in Wales at any ruleset.

In my opinion that’s perfect for everyone with loads of options to play pool and only following the standard being set in the vast majority of other countries worldwide.

If it’s put to a vote and goes through and some leagues decide to not get involved then so be it and inter league would need to adjust to that going forward.

I look forward to seeing you at the meeting.



Yours in sport

Zak Shepherd and Wayne Smith
